Uniper and Evonik launch high-temp heat pump
Uniper and Evonik are commissioning a highly innovative high-temperature heat pump that supplies district heating to around 1,000 households in the Ruhr region. The system is installed at Evonik’ s Herne site and is operated with support from Iqony, with Uniper responsible for financing, planning, installation, and operation. The heat pump captures lowtemperature industrial waste heat from Evonik’ s chemical production processes, where cooling water is typically warmed to around 25 – 30 ° C. Instead of being rejected via cooling towers, this waste heat is upgraded by the heat pump to temperatures of up to 130 ° C, making it suitable for injection into an existing district heating network. The system delivers up to 1.5 MW of thermal output. This marks the first installation in Germany capable of raising industrial waste heat by more than 100 ° C at megawatt scale, addressing a key limitation of conventional heat pump technology and enabling integration with high-temperature district heating systems. The project is expected to avoid approximately 1,750 tons of CO 2 emissions annually by replacing fossil fuel-based heat generation. It also improves energy efficiency at the Evonik site by reducing electricity consumption associated with cooling towers. The initiative has a pilot character, with Uniper, Evonik, and Iqony evaluating potential scale-up opportunities. In the future, up to 20 MW of additional industrial waste heat could be integrated into the system. The project supports Evonik’ s broader decarbonisation strategy and demonstrates the potential of industrial waste heat recovery to contribute to climate-neutral urban energy systems.
LUVE Tianmen achieves HACCP certification
LU-VE Heat Exchanger( Tianmen) Co., Ltd. has successfully obtained the HACCP(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points) certification, a globally recognized standard for food safety management. The certification was issued by TÜV NORD CERT GmbH and is valid till 29 October 2028. This important achievement confirms that our plant in Tianmen complies with the Codex Alimentarius International Code of Practice – General Principles of
Food Hygiene( CXC 1-1969, Rev. 2020), ensuring that all processes related to the manufacture of air coolers for food processing and storage meet the highest hygiene and safety requirements.
